Phone trivia:

GSM's still around. Here in the US, there was GSM and mostly-Verizon CDMA. The major difference was in how crowded channels were handled; whether the intelligence to handle that was in the handset (CDMA) or the tower (GSM). There was a lot of "which one will win?" like there was between VHS and BetaMax, but unlike those, CDMA and GSM have pretty much merged into LTE - and channel congestion is mostly a non issue due to the move to spread spectrum - other connections are similar enough to noise that they can be filtered out.
